Option 3: Using a wireless CarPlay adapter
If you simply want to eliminate cables from your setup, a wireless adapter is the easiest and fastest way. It retains your original system but makes CarPlay significantly more convenient.

Step by step: How to install wireless CarPlay in an older car

Step 1: Start your car to power the infotainment system so the device can connect.
Step 2: Plug the adapter into the USB CarPlay port. If there is no dedicated port, use the main USB data port.
Step 3: Wait for the on-screen messages. The display will indicate that a new device is loading (usually 10–20 seconds).
Step 4: Open Bluetooth on your smartphone and pair with the adapter. The device will do the rest automatically.
Once these steps are completed, the device will connect automatically every time you start your car.
